Charity overview

Activities - how the charity spends its money

Assisting those in need by reason of youth, age, ill-health, disability, financial hardship and other disadvantage to assess relief from the local authority and from the charitable organisation. Providing relief through food bank, tea mornings and community visitations. Providing computer training for young people and willing adults.
